#503ec3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#503ec3 is composed of 31.4% red, 24.3%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 50.4%. #503ec3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a07cff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#503ec3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#503ec3 has RGB values of R:80, G:62,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5258947.

Hex triplet 503ec3 #503ec3
RGB Decimal 80, 62, 195 rgb(80,62,195)
RGB Percent 31.4, 24.3, 76.5 rgb(31.4%,24.3%,76.5%)
CMYK 59, 68, 0, 24
HSL 248.1°, 52.6, 50.4 hsl(248.1,52.6%,50.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 248.1°, 68.2, 76.5
Web Safe 6633cc #6633cc
CIE-LAB 36.158, 44.658, -67
XYZ 14.879, 9.09, 52.597
xyY 0.194, 0.119, 9.09
CIE-LCH 36.158, 80.519, 303.685
CIE-LUV 36.158, -2.465, -95.698
Hunter-Lab 30.15, 35.328, -82.327
Binary 01010000, 00111110, 11000011

Shades and Tints of #503ec3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#503ec3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7889 is the less saturated color, while #2504fd is the most saturated one.
